Understanding the Platform Architecture: Orders vs. Parcels

Before diving into the “how-to,” it is vital to understand the “what.” Many users confuse “Orders” with “Parcels,” leading to frustration when trying to find the refund button. AllChinaBuy, like most proxy agents, operates on a two-step logic:

1. The Order (Procurement)

This is the transaction between you and the agent to buy an item from a seller (e.g., Weidian, Taobao). Refunding this means returning the item to the seller.

2. The Parcel (Logistics)

This is the transaction between you and the agent to ship your stored items to your home country. Refunding this means cancelling the international shipping label.

This guide specifically focuses on The Parcel phase—when you have already paid for international shipping and need to reverse that decision.

Step-by-Step: Cancelling a Parcel Before Packing

One of the most common anxieties I encounter is the fear of losing money once a “Submit Delivery” button is clicked. However, the AllChinaBuy parcel cancellation and refund guide is actually quite straightforward if you act within the correct timeframe.

When you submit a parcel, you are essentially creating a “work order” for the warehouse staff. This work order sits in a queue. Until a staff member physically scans that order to begin packing, you have a “Golden Window” of opportunity. Here is my personal workflow for cancelling a shipment during this phase:

The “Golden Window” Workflow
  1. Log in to User Center: Access your main dashboard. Do not use the mobile app if possible; the desktop version offers more granular control over cancellations.
  2. Navigate to “My Parcels”: Ensure you are not in the “My Orders” tab. This specific tab tracks international outbound shipments.
  3. Analyze the Status Code: Look closely at the status.
    • Verifying: The system is checking your payment. (Cancelable)
    • Submitted: The order is in the queue. (Cancelable)
    • Pending Packing: Assigned to a packer but not started. (Cancelable)
  4. Locate “Cancel Parcel”: On the right-hand side of the parcel entry, look for a gray or red text link/button labeled “Cancel.”
  5. Select Reason Code: You will be asked for a reason. Common options include “Change shipping method,” “Add more items,” or “Personal reasons.” Pro Tip: Selecting “Add more items” often processes faster as the system assumes you will re-spend the money.
  6. Confirmation: Once confirmed, the status will immediately change to “Cancelled.” The items will return to your “Warehouse” tab, and the shipping fee returns to your balance.

The “Emergency Stop”: Cancelling After Submission

This is the tricky part. Many users ask me how to cancel AllChinaBuy parcel after submitting delivery when the status has moved past the initial “Submitted” phase. Timing is absolutely critical here.

Once the status changes to “Packed,” “Waybill Generated,” or “Picked up by Courier,” the electronic “Cancel” button often disappears from the user interface. This is because the physical package has likely left the warehouse shelf and is sitting in a loading bay or a truck. The system locks the order to prevent inventory errors.

However, as someone who works with these warehouses daily, I can tell you that “Packed” does not always mean “Gone.” Here is my proprietary “Emergency Stop” protocol:

Protocol: The Manual Intercept

If the button is gone but the parcel hasn’t been scanned by the international courier (DHL, EMS, UPS) yet, take these actions immediately:

1. Check Beijing Time

Support typically operates 9:00 AM – 6:00 PM (GMT+8). If it is currently night in China, your chances of an intercept drop significantly as the night shift logistics crew may load the truck before support opens.

2. Use Live Chat (NOT Email)

Do not send an email. Emails have a 24-hour turnaround. You need real-time intervention. Open the “Online Support” widget.

3. The Script

Provide Parcel Number (PN) immediately. Say: “URGENT: Please intercept Parcel PN123456789. I need to change the shipping line. Please contact the warehouse manager to hold the package.”

Critical Logistics Insight: If the status is “Shipped” and a tracking number (e.g., LY123456CN) has been generated and shows an “Acceptance” scan, it is generally impossible to cancel. The logistics train has left the station, and the package is in the custody of a third-party carrier who will not return it without a fee larger than the value of the goods.

How to Withdraw AllChinaBuy Balance to Bank Account

Once you have successfully cancelled a parcel, the money does not automatically boomerang back to your credit card. This is a common misconception. The funds return to your Platform Wallet (Balance).

To get the cash in hand, you need to know how to withdraw AllChinaBuy balance to bank account. I have guided many clients through this because they often panic when they see the money just “sitting” there. Here is the reality of the financial flow:

The Closed-Loop Anti-Money Laundering (AML) Policy

AllChinaBuy, like most purchasing agents, adheres to strict international AML policies. This dictates one simple rule: Funds must return to the source.

  • If you paid via PayPal: You can only withdraw to that specific PayPal account.
  • If you paid via Stripe/Credit Card: The refund must be processed as a transaction reversal to that specific card.
  • If you paid via Top-Up (Transfer): It must be wired back to the originating bank account.

Step-by-Step Withdrawal Execution

  1. Go to “Wallet” or “Balance”: In your user dashboard, locate your financial overview.
  2. Select “Withdraw”: You will usually see “Top Up” (Green) and “Withdraw” (Blue/Grey).
  3. Enter Amount: Input the amount (in CNY) you wish to withdraw. The system will show the estimated conversion.
  4. Submit Request: The finance team will review it. This is a manual review to prevent fraud.

AllChinaBuy Refund Processing Time for International Parcels

Patience is a virtue in international trade, but knowing the precise timelines helps manage expectations (and blood pressure). The AllChinaBuy refund processing time for international parcels varies significantly depending on the “Leg” of the refund.

Based on my experience observing hundreds of transactions and recent 2024 data, here is a detailed breakdown of the wait times you should expect:

Refund Stage Processing Time (Agent Side) Arrival Time (Your Bank) Notes
Parcel Cancel -> Wallet Instant – 1 Hour N/A Available immediately for other purchases.
Wallet -> PayPal 1 – 3 Business Days Instant – 48 Hours Fastest method. PayPal fees are rarely refunded.
Wallet -> Credit Card 1 – 3 Business Days 5 – 15 Business Days Depends heavily on your local bank’s clearing cycle.
Wallet -> Wise/Bank Transfer 3 – 5 Business Days 1 – 4 Business Days Subject to SWIFT processing times and holidays.

Warning: The Currency Exchange Loss

Be aware that you will likely receive less money than you originally deposited. This is due to double conversion. When you paid, you converted USD/EUR to CNY (Buy Rate). When you withdraw, the agent converts CNY back to USD/EUR (Sell Rate). The spread between these rates, plus PayPal/Stripe processing fees (usually 3-4% + $0.30), is a sunk cost of doing business internationally.

How to Return Items from AllChinaBuy Warehouse for Full Refund

Sometimes, the issue isn’t the shipping, but the items themselves. Perhaps the “Quality Control” (QC) photos revealed a stain on a jacket, or the color is wrong. Knowing how to return items from AllChinaBuy warehouse for full refund is essential for quality control before you even think about shipping.

The Critical 5-Day Rule

Most sellers on Chinese domestic marketplaces (like Weidian, Taobao, or 1688) offer a 7-day return window. However, the clock starts ticking when the package is signed for at the warehouse, not when you view the photos. By the time the warehouse unpacks, photographs, and uploads the data, 2 or 3 days may have already passed.

Therefore, you effectively have a strict 5-day window (often less) from the moment the item status becomes “Stored” to request a return. If you wait 2 weeks to ship your haul, the return window has closed, and the seller will refuse the refund.

The Return Workflow

  • Inspect QC Immediately: Never let items sit in “Stored” status for days without checking photos.
  • Click “Return/Exchange”: Found in the “My Orders” tab next to the specific item.
  • Upload Evidence: If the item is damaged, circle the defect in the QC photo and upload it. This forces the seller to pay return shipping.
  • “Change of Mind”: If you just don’t like it, you must agree to pay the domestic return shipping fee. This is usually 10-20 CNY ($1.50 – $3.00 USD). It is deducted from your refund.

AllChinaBuy Seized Parcel Refund Insurance Policy

In my line of work dealing with luxury sourcing, customs safety is paramount. One of the most frequent long-tail queries I address is regarding the AllChinaBuy seized parcel refund insurance policy.

Shipping internationally always carries a risk of customs seizure or loss. While rare (affecting less than 1% of standard parcels), it happens. AllChinaBuy, like other agents, offers insurance, but it is not automatic—you must purchase it. If you do not buy insurance and your parcel is seized, you will receive $0 compensation.

Risk A: The Lost Package

Definition: Tracking stops updating for 45-60 days.
Insurance Covers: Full item value + Shipping cost.
Without Insurance: Usually capped at 3x shipping fee (max).

Risk B: Customs Seizure

Definition: Customs confiscates goods (IP violation, restricted items).
Insurance Covers: Varies by line. “Seizure Insurance” specifically refunds item + shipping.
Without Insurance: $0. Total loss.

Expert Tip: Not all shipping lines support insurance. “Budget” lines often exclude luxury items from coverage. Always stick to lines like EMS, PD-Line, or Duty-Free Lines if you are shipping branded goods, as these often allow for “Customs Seizure” add-ons.

Recovering Funds: The “Weight Difference” Refund

There is another scenario for recovering funds from an AllChinaBuy parcel that is actually a pleasant surprise: the shipping deposit refund.

When you pay for shipping, you are paying an estimate based on the agent’s projected weight and volume. However, logistics is precise. Once the warehouse staff actually packs the box, cuts down the cardboard, and removes unnecessary shoe boxes (if you selected that option), the actual weight is often lower than the estimated weight.

How the Automatic Refund Works

For example, if you paid for 5kg ($80) but the final parcel was 4.2kg ($65):

  • Scenario: Estimated 5000g -> Actual 4200g.
  • Outcome: The difference ($15) is automatically returned to your AllChinaBuy balance.
  • Timing: Usually within 72 hours of dispatch.

Pro Tip: Use “Rehearsal Packaging”. If you are tight on funds, pay ~20 CNY for “Rehearsal Packaging.” The warehouse will pack the box before you pay the shipping fee. This updates the weight in the system to the exact gram, meaning you pay the precise amount upfront and don’t have to wait for a refund.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Can I get a refund if I refuse the package at my door?

Short answer: No. If you refuse a package, it is either destroyed by the carrier or returned to China. Return shipping costs are often astronomical (sometimes $200+) and will be deducted from any potential refund. It is financially safer to accept the package and resell the items locally.

What happens if I used a coupon on a cancelled parcel?

If you follow the cancellation process correctly, the coupon used is typically returned to your account instantly, provided it hasn’t expired during the interim period. However, limited-time event coupons may be lost.

How to refund on AllChinaBuy on parcel if the courier loses it?

You must file a claim through the “My Parcels” tab using the “After-Sales” button. You will need to provide the tracking history showing no movement. The investigation (carrier probe) takes 15-60 days. If you purchased insurance, you get paid after the investigation confirms loss.

Does AllChinaBuy refund to PayPal directly?

No, they refund to your AllChinaBuy Balance first. You must then manually initiate a withdrawal request from your balance to move the funds to your PayPal account.
